Lodging & Arrival Information - Jakarta, Indonesia  


 

Lodging

Homestay
We recommend students take advantage of staying in a homestay to practice their Bahasa Indonesia and be exposed to the local culture. For many of our students, their homestay is one of the most rewarding experiences. Our Jakarta host families are exceptionally warm and generous. They love sharing their homes, language and culture with our students.

Homestays with Nazroh Homestay families are arranged by the school. Host families are carefully selected to ensure that all homes are safe, secure and clean. The school carefully inspects all homes, and admits only families of good reputation to their accommodation service. The homestay coordinator supervises homestay families on a regular basis. Most homes are in the suburbs and all homestay families live within a reasonable distance from the school. The average time is 20 - 60 minutes from the school by public transportation. Depending on the meal plan, students will be provided with two or three meals per day, including breakfast and dinner. Meals are also provided on weekends. Laundering of sheets and towels is done once a week.

Please be sure to specify on the registration form any specific preferences you may have, such as dietary requirements, health concerns (i.e. allergies), etc. The homestay coordinator can make any necessary changes in your lodging arrangements if necessary.

Family homestay accommodation includes a private or shared single room with a bed, closet, and desk. Shared accommodation is available for two people traveling together.

Please note: There is usually a high demand for family accommodation, so homestay requests are filled on a first-come-first-serve basis.

Hotels in Jakarta
Students studying in Jakarta for a short period of time may stay in a hotel, bed & breakfast or hostel close to the school, options which are available upon request at an additional cost.

Lodging information is sent 7 - 14 days prior to departure. Information of where to go and how to get there will be sent to students prior to departure. In addition, NRCSA will send emergency contact in case of any problem.
